**Ticket TIMR-state for weekly sync**

The ChronoPass chip reader at the Velden Harbor Marathon dropped roughly 40 reads near the 10k mat. Looks like the antenna multiplexer firmware starves when two runners cross within 8 ms. Not a race-day blocker since backup mats caught everyone, but let's patch before the Oakridge event. Repro logs are attached; the failing firmware build is identified by the token below.

pipeline stamp: htk9_ce63042d9

During the Fenwright Trade Fair, Calloway Instruments is running a pop-up office in Hall 4, stand F-22, at the Osterbridge Exhibition Grounds. Reception staff rotating through should arrive by 08:30 — the hall opens to exhibitors an hour before the public. Lanyards are in the grey case under the front counter; badges stay on at all times. The back storage cabin behind the stand locks automatically, so let yourselves in with the code below.

door code, yagap-bahof: bdg-O-05

Handover note — Crumbwheel order cutoffs.

Welcome aboard. The bakery cutoff rule in Crumbwheel closes same-day orders at 14:00 local to each storefront, not UTC — this has bitten us twice. Holiday overrides live in the calendar service and take precedence silently, so always check there first when a cutoff looks wrong. To unlock the calendar service's admin console after a restart, enter the recovery passphrase below.

vault phrase of bagap-bahaf = silion-pelox-sorox-casdor-quenwyn-fraax-eliox-praael-kelion-quenvan-kasox-rusael-norius-belvan

Vendor note: the color-contrast audit for the Glimmerkit plugin surface is handled by Hueward Labs. Scope covers all plugin-rendered UI against WCAG AA ratios; dark-mode variants included. Plugin authors must supply a staging build by the end of the sprint. Hueward reports findings as severity-tagged tickets; fix windows are 30 days for high severity. Do not ship palette changes mid-audit. To schedule your plugin's review slot, contact the Hueward coordination inbox at the address below.

escalation mailbox, hadug-bajog: sormir@norvalabs.internal